x^2+4x-12=2
We move all terms to the left:
x^2+4x-12-(2)=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
x^2+4x-14=0
a = 1; b = 4; c = -14;
Δ = b2-4ac
Δ = 42-4·1·(-14)
Δ = 72
The delta value is higher than zero, so the equation has two solutions
We use following formulas to calculate our solutions:$x_{1}=\frac{-b-\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}$$x_{2}=\frac{-b+\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}$
The end solution:
$\sqrt{\Delta}=\sqrt{72}=\sqrt{36*2}=\sqrt{36}*\sqrt{2}=6\sqrt{2}$$x_{1}=\frac{-b-\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}=\frac{-(4)-6\sqrt{2}}{2*1}=\frac{-4-6\sqrt{2}}{2} $$x_{2}=\frac{-b+\sqrt{\Delta}}{2a}=\frac{-(4)+6\sqrt{2}}{2*1}=\frac{-4+6\sqrt{2}}{2} $
